Tagalog edit
Etymology edit
Borrowed from Spanish musculado, influenced by the pronunciation of English muscle.
Pronunciation edit
- (Standard Tagalog) IPA(key): /maskuˈlado/ [mɐs.kʊˈla.do]
- Rhymes: -ado
- Syllabification: mas‧ku‧la‧do
Adjective edit
maskulado (Baybayin spelling ᜋᜐ᜔ᜃᜓᜎᜇᜓ)
